Wolves open their 2019-20 Premier League season today with a visit to loocal rivals Leicester City. It will be the first PL meeting between Nunu Espirito Santo and Brendan Rodgers.
Following their comprehensive win in Armenia in the Europa League this week Wolves will be hoping to continue of a high this afternoon and avenge the loss at their opponents ground early last season. Nuno has not appeared in a press conference or Official Site interview prior to this match, probably because of the travelling he has done with the team, however his mantra will undoubtedly continue to be unchanged.
